---
title: NDArray.ScalarType.int4
framework: coreai
role: symbol
role_heading: Case
path: coreai/ndarray/scalartype-swift.enum/int4
---

# NDArray.ScalarType.int4

A 4-bit signed integer.

## Declaration

```swift
case int4
```

## Discussion

Discussion Four-bit signed integers can represent values in the range [-8, 7]. Widely used in model quantization for efficient storage and computation.

## See Also

### Defining sub-byte signed integer types

- [NDArray.ScalarType.int2](coreai/ndarray/scalartype-swift.enum/int2.md)
- [NDArray.ScalarType.int3](coreai/ndarray/scalartype-swift.enum/int3.md)
- [NDArray.ScalarType.int5](coreai/ndarray/scalartype-swift.enum/int5.md)
- [NDArray.ScalarType.int6](coreai/ndarray/scalartype-swift.enum/int6.md)
- [NDArray.ScalarType.int7](coreai/ndarray/scalartype-swift.enum/int7.md)
